Where to Soak Up New York City's LGBTQ History

"Named for Marsha P. Johnson, a pivotal player in 1969's Stonewall uprising, this is the first new York state park to honor a trans woman of color. The entry gate pays homage to Johnson’s signature floral hairpiece, and Johnson’s signature phrase “pay it no mind” adorns the entry to inspire generations of activists not to be deterred by their oppressors. Oddly enough, the waterfront park in Williamsburg doesn’t allow dogs despite Johnson herself being a dog lover." - Melissa Kravitz Hoeffner
